North Cotabato Governor Emmylou “Lala” Taliño-Mendoza led the distribution of assistance to the former NPA rebels and its supporters together with Department of Social Welfare and Development (DSWD) and Provincial Task Force on Ending Local Communist Armed Conflict of Cotabato Province.
Each PO received P300,000 as livelihood aid and a Certificate of Accreditation.
The respective presidents and treasurers of the five organizations from Makilala, nine from President Roxas, four from Tulunan and four from Antipas all from Cotabato Province personally received the checks in behalf of their respective organizations.
The 22 POs had been organized by the Philippine Army’s 39th Infantry Battalion and 72nd Infantry Battalion under 10th Infantry Division after they withdrew their support to the NPA and when their communities were declared insurgency cleared.
The Sustainable Livelihood Program (SLP) is a community-based development program geared towards improving the socio-economic status of the POs and their respective communities.
